Decca matrix L 7364. Street of dreams / Les Brown and his Band of Renown

Additional Information
Notes
Master renumbered as 86021.
Ruppli session note: All titles, except 86021, also issued on Coral CRL-56116.
Ruppli session personnel note: Wes Hensel, Don Paladino, Stan Stout, Don Fagerquist (trumpet), Ray Sims, Dick Noel, Bob Pring (trombone), Clyde "Stumpy" Brown (bass trombone), Les Brown, Sol Libero (clarinet, alto saxophone), Ronnie Lang (flute, alto saxophone), Dave Pell (tenor saxophone), Abe Aaron (soprano saxophone, tenor saxophone, baritone saxophone), Butch Stone (baritone saxophone), Geoff Clarkson (piano), Ralph Hensel (vibraphone), Vernon Polk (guitar), Rollie Bundock (bass), Jack Sperling (drums), Frank Comstock (arranger).
